Interview with Cate O’Connor – The Labyrinth

by Joshua (J.Smo) Smotherman November 28, 2023 10:33 am Tagged With: alt-pop, indie pop, Pop, singer, songwriter, United States

Cate O'Connor-The Labyrinth

Cate O’Conner is set to take her audience on a haunting journey through a darkly twisted fairytale gone wrong in her latest music video, “The Labyrinth.” This cinematic masterpiece, directed by Glennellen Anderson (Stranger Things), weaves a narrative that transcends traditional music videos, exploring themes of self-love and the perils of seeking love in all the wrong places.

In this interview spotlight, I chat with Cate about the new project, AI in the music biz, dream collabs, and more.

AI (aka Artificial Intelligence aka Chat GPT 4.0)… How is it changing the music world? What are your thoughts about this new trend?

AI is changing the music world definitely but it’s such a new thing that we don’t really know what the rules of it are. Because AI is drawing from copyrighted music it’s difficult to find the line of what’s protected and what’s not. I think it causes issues for artists like a fear of devaluing their work and a fear of replacing them entirely. 

What is your favorite song of all time? 

My favorite song of all time is Soldier, Poet, King by The Oh Hellos. It’s so beautifully written, poetic, and paints an image and I love music that does that. 

What about this project makes you most proud? Was there a specific goal you were trying to accomplish with this video?

Stepping outside of my comfort zone and just having the courage to release it makes me the most proud. The goal I was trying to accomplish with the video is to convey the story of how toxic relationships can break you but with healing, looking back on them can be seen as a victory. 

What inspires you to create music? What motivates you to keep going?

Music has always been an outlet for me- it’s engrained in who I am as a person. My experiences and my love for storytelling inspire me to create music. I have an amazing support system that continually encourage me and motivate me to keep making music. This definitely isn’t the last you’ll hear of me. 

If you could collaborate with anyone – dead or alive, famous or unknown – who would it be and why?

I would collaborate with Ed Sheeran. He’s been my biggest musical influence and I have such a respect for his lyricism and talent. 

What was the last song you listened to? Favorite all-time bands/artists?

The last song I listened to was when the party’s over by Billie Eilish. She’s my guilty pleasure artist.  Favorite all-time artists are probably Ed Sheeran and Taylor Swift.
